Habitat for Humanity Central Arizona’s (HFHCAZ) philosophy is that shelter is a basic human need and that everyone deserves a simple decent place in which to live and grow. We believe that without decent shelter, people are robbed of hope for the future. By working together, volunteers and families transcend cultural, status, and racial boundaries while providing affordable housing in neighborhoods in need.
Our main focus in the housing arena is providing detached single family homes. We prioritize our applicants based on need. Through volunteer labor and donations, Habitat builds and renovates simple, decent, affordable housing. Habitat partner families must invest “sweat equity” in helping to build their home and make affordable monthly mortgage payments on a no-interest loan. We are a hand up, not a hand out.
